Brassicas do smell more than most sprouts - it is a sulfur smell which you might notice sounds similar to sulfurophane, the anti-oxidant in Broccoli and other Brassicas, so a little smell is a good thing. Sprouts smell off or rancid because the humid conditions for sprouting encourage bacteria and fungi to grow, and these release compounds with nasty smells. Relating to or secreting mucilage. Sprouts may go moldy due to inefficient rinsing/draining, lack of air circulation, standing puddles of water in the sprouter, or poor food-handling hygiene. The most extreme hard seed story: We have even experienced seeds so determined to stay hard (Adzukisin 1995) that they required 3 consecutive 12 hourSoaksin hot water! If Heat and Humidity are high, and moving theSprouterwon't do it, turn a fan on (not blowing right at the sprouts) to move the air, add an extraRinseto your daily routine, or at the very least, use cold water instead of cool when youRinse.
